First off, let's talk about what torque actually is. In simple terms, torque is a measure of the force that can cause an object to rotate around an axis. It's what makes things spin! When it comes to Accumulation Rollers, torque plays a crucial role in their operation.
Accumulation Rollers are used in conveyor systems to accumulate products in a buffer zone. They allow products to be stopped and started without causing damage or jams. The torque of an Accumulation Roller determines how much force it can apply to move or hold products on the conveyor.
There are a few factors that can affect the torque of an Accumulation Roller. One of the main factors is the type of roller. For example, Accumulation Sprocket Steel Roller are known for their durability and high torque capabilities. These rollers are made of steel and have sprockets that engage with a chain drive, providing a strong and reliable source of power.
Another factor that can affect torque is the size of the roller. Generally speaking, larger rollers have more torque than smaller ones. This is because they have a greater surface area and can apply more force to the products on the conveyor.
The speed of the conveyor also plays a role in the torque requirements of an Accumulation Roller. If the conveyor is moving at a high speed, the rollers will need to have more torque to keep up with the flow of products. On the other hand, if the conveyor is moving at a slower speed, the rollers may not need as much torque.
In addition to these factors, the weight and size of the products being conveyed can also impact the torque requirements. Heavier and larger products will require more torque to move and hold in place than lighter and smaller ones.
So, how do you determine the right torque for your Accumulation Rollers? Well, it really depends on your specific application. You'll need to consider factors such as the type of products being conveyed, the speed of the conveyor, and the size and weight of the rollers.


One way to determine the torque requirements is to consult with a professional engineer or conveyor system designer. They can help you analyze your application and recommend the appropriate rollers and torque levels.
Another option is to conduct some tests on your own. You can start by using rollers with a lower torque rating and gradually increasing the torque until you find the right balance. This will allow you to see how the rollers perform under different conditions and make adjustments as needed.
It's also important to note that the torque requirements of an Accumulation Roller can change over time. As the rollers wear down or the conveyor system is modified, the torque requirements may need to be adjusted. That's why it's a good idea to regularly monitor the performance of your rollers and make any necessary changes.
